Righting wrongs: How Joyce Watkins was exonerated in court
CBSN
In 1988 Joyce Watkins and her boyfriend, Charlie Dunn, were wrongfully convicted of a terrible crime: the murder of Watkins' four-year-old great-niece, Brandi.
Watkins said, "It took everything away from us. It took us from our families, him from his kids. Took us from everything we worked for."
Dunn died in prison in 2015. But last December, in a Nashville, Tennessee courtroom, the 74-year old Watkins finally heard from the Davidson County District Attorney General Glenn Funk the words she had prayed for: "I want to say to both Ms. Watkins, and to the family of Charlie Dunn, that I believe they were actually innocent."
